And for other companies, all that may be required are … WebSeven steps to a successful business restructure. 1. Where do you start a restructure? Well, you start at the end. This is the most important piece of advice I can give. Forget what is now – consider where you are going, what the business goals are and what you need to do to deliver them.

Web16 jan. 2024 · 11. Undergo debt restructuring. If debt consolidation can’t help, owners can apply to restructure their debt. Debt restructuring usually occurs when the business is on the brink of a financial crisis.
